The Southern Tier Community Center Story

Once the Boys and Girls Club of Western Broome County closed its doors in 2019, it was no secret that an individual, business, or organization needed to step up and purchase this pillar of the community.

The Children’s Home, which has been improving the lives of children and families for more than 100 years, saw a valuable opportunity to expand and strengthen our mission.

With the support of stakeholders and the community, the Children’s Home finalized the purchase of the former Boys & Girls Club of Western Broome County building on May 12, 2020 and marked its new era with a new name: “Southern Tier Community Center.”

Our goal was to revitalize the physical building, as well as expand child care, fitness, and community outreach programming. Nikki Post was hired as Director of the Southern Tier Community Center, and she continues to lead the center’s programs and development.

We have come a long way since 2020, but we’re not done making the STCC a one-of-a-kind place for all community members to enjoy. Major revitalization plans are still in the works and underway with support from local foundations.
